VectorReaderIter#
Added in version 1.2.
Superclasses: Object
Reads the layers and features of a vector tile.
To create a new VectorReaderIter
, use iterate
.
A vector tile consists of named layers, which contain features. Each feature has an ID, a geometry, and a set of key/value tags. The meanings of the IDs and tags depends on the data source that the tile came from. The OpenMapTiles schema is a common schema for vector tiles.
To read all layers in a tile, use get_layer_count
and
read_layer
. If you know the name of the layer you
want, you can also use read_layer_by_name
.
Once the iterator is reading a layer, you can call
next_feature
in a loop to read all the features in
the layer.
A VectorReaderIter
is not thread-safe, but iterators created
from the same VectorReader
can be used in different threads.
See the Mapbox Vector Tile specification for more information about the vector tile format.
Methods#
- class VectorReaderIter
- feature_contains_point(x: float, y: float) bool #
Determines whether the current feature contains the given point.
The point must be specified in tile space. See
get_layer_extent
to get the range of the coordinates.Only polygon or multipolygon features can contain a point. For all other feature types, this function returns
False
.If the point is on the border of the polygon, this function may return either
True
orFalse
.Added in version 1.2.

- get_layer_extent() int #
Gets the extent for coordinates in the current layer.
0 represents the top and left edges of the tile, and this value represents the bottom and right edges. Feature geometries may extend outside of this range, since tiles often include some margin.
Tiles do not contain metadata about the location of the tile within the world, so it is up to the caller to know the tile’s coordinates and convert latitude/longitude to tile-space coordinates.
Added in version 1.2.

- read_layer_by_name(name: str) bool #
Moves the iterator to the layer with the given name, if present.
If the layer is not found, the current layer will be set to
None
and the function will returnFalse
. Layers are typically omitted if they are empty, so don’t assume that a layer in the schema will always be present.The iterator’s current feature will be
None
after calling this function; usenext_feature
to advance to the first feature in the layer.Added in version 1.2.
